What makes someone eligible for SSDI?

To be eligible for SSDI in Gilbert, you must have worked and paid Social Security taxes for a certain number of years. Your medical condition must be severe enough to prevent you from doing substantial gainful activity and is expected to last at least 12 months or result in death. The SSA evaluates both your medical condition and your work history.

Is the ticket to work program a trap?

The Ticket to Work program is designed to help SSDI beneficiaries return to work. It offers various services like vocational training and job placement assistance. While some may find it challenging, it's not inherently a trap. It's important to understand the program's details and choose services that align with your personal goals and capabilities.

What is the difference between SSI and SSDI?

SSDI is a benefit for those who have a work history and paid Social Security taxes. SSI, on the other hand, is a needs-based program for individuals with limited income and resources who are disabled, blind, or aged 65 or older. Eligibility criteria differ significantly between the two programs.

What does SSDI usually pay?

The amount you receive from SSDI in Arizona is based on your average lifetime earnings. It's not a fixed amount.
